MySQL语句控制技巧大揭秘

资源类型:qilanfushi.com 2025-07-23 09:55

mysql语句控制简介:



掌握MySQL语句控制,高效决策,引领企业数据未来 在当今数据驱动的时代,数据库管理系统(DBMS)已成为企业运营不可或缺的核心组件

    其中,MySQL以其开源、易用、性能稳定等特点,赢得了众多企业的青睐

    然而,要想充分发挥MySQL的潜能,熟练掌握其语句控制显得尤为重要

    本文旨在深入探讨MySQL语句控制的精髓,助力读者在数据海洋中高效决策,引领企业数据未来

     一、MySQL语句控制的重要性 MySQL语句控制,简而言之,就是通过一系列SQL命令来操纵数据库中的数据

    这些命令包括但不限于数据的增删改查、数据库结构的修改以及权限的设置等

    掌握MySQL语句控制,意味着能够精准地定位数据、高效地处理数据,从而为企业带来以下显著优势: 1.提高数据处理效率:通过优化查询语句,减少不必要的数据扫描和传输,大幅提升数据检索速度

     2.保障数据安全:合理设置用户权限,防止数据泄露和非法篡改,确保企业数据资产的安全

     3.增强数据灵活性:灵活运用SQL语句,实现复杂的数据转换和逻辑处理,满足多样化的业务需求

     二、MySQL语句控制的核心要点 1.数据查询(SELECT) 数据查询是MySQL语句控制中最常用也最复杂的部分

    通过SELECT语句,用户可以从一个或多个表中检索数据

    为了提高查询效率,应学会使用WHERE子句来过滤不必要的记录,以及利用JOIN操作来关联多个表

    此外,掌握聚合函数(如SUM、AVG等)和子查询的使用,能够进一步丰富查询结果,满足复杂的分析需求

     2.数据操纵(DML) 数据操纵语言(DML)包括INSERT、UPDATE和DELETE等语句,用于对数据库中的数据进行增删改操作

    在使用DML语句时,务必确保操作的准确性和原子性,避免因误操作导致数据丢失或不一致

    同时,合理利用事务(Transaction)机制,可以确保一系列DML操作的完整性和一致性

     3.数据定义(DDL) 数据定义语言(DDL)主要涉及数据库结构的创建、修改和删除等操作

    通过CREATE TABLE、ALTER TABLE和DROP TABLE等语句,用户可以灵活地调整数据库模式以适应业务变化

    在进行DDL操作时,需要谨慎评估其对现有数据和应用程序的影响,确保平滑过渡

     4.权限控制(GRANT/REVOKE) MySQL提供了强大的权限控制机制,允许管理员根据用户需求精确地分配或撤销数据库访问权限

    通过GRANT和REVOKE语句,可以实现对用户、角色或主机在特定数据库或表上的操作权限的精细管理

    合理的权限设置不仅有助于保护数据安全,还能提升系统的整体安全性

     三、MySQL语句控制的实践建议 1.持续学习:MySQL及其相关技术在不断发展中,因此保持对新特性的关注和学习至关重要

     2.性能调优:定期审查和优化SQL语句,利用索引、分区等技术手段提高查询性能

     3.备份与恢复:建立完善的备份机制,并定期测试恢复流程,确保在紧急情况下能够迅速恢复数据

     4.安全加固:除了权限控制外,还应考虑使用SSL加密连接、定期更新密码等安全措施来增强数据库的安全性

     四、结语 MySQL语句控制是数据库管理的核心技能之一

    通过深入学习和实践,我们不仅能够提升个人在数据领域的竞争力,还能为企业带来更高效、更安全的数据处理体验

    在这个数据为王的时代,让我们携手共进,用MySQL语句控制的力量引领企业数据未来!

阅读全文
上一篇:MySQL大数据量分表策略,轻松应对数据挑战

最新收录:

  • MySQL自增设置技巧:轻松管理数据库主键
  • MySQL大数据量分表策略,轻松应对数据挑战
  • MySQL高手必修课:轻松掌握指定字符替换技巧!
  • C语言轻松连接MySQL:数据库操作神器来袭!
  • 标题建议:《解决启动MySQL遭遇1067错误的秘诀》
  • 深入解析:MySQL事务的原理与应用
  • MySQL范围查询技巧大揭秘
  • MyBatis助力MySQL数据高效迁移
  • Python脚本快速删除MySQL数据
  • MySQL数据库:掌握默认值与非空约束的奥秘
  • 揭秘MySQL5.7 OCP真题,备考攻略大放送!
  • MySQL删除表索引教程
  • 首页 | mysql语句控制:MySQL语句控制技巧大揭秘